What is Hallucinogen Farming and Its Purpose?

Hallucinogen farming refers to the cultivation of plants and fungi that produce psychoactive compounds. Common examples include psilocybin mushrooms and peyote cacti. These substances have been used for centuries in various cultural and spiritual practices.

Carbon Footprint of Various Hallucinogen Species

Different hallucinogenic species have unique farming carbon footprints. For instance, psilocybin mushrooms typically require less land and water compared to large-scale crops like peyote. This means that their overall environmental impact can be lower if farmed sustainably.

However, the cultivation of peyote often involves more extensive land use and longer growth cycles, which increases its carbon footprint. The challenge lies in balancing the demand for these different species with their environmental implications.
